Basic salary, also known as basic pay, is the first and most important component of your salary structure, and many other salary components, such as HRA, Provident Fund, Gratuity, ESIC, and so on, are calculated as a percentage of basic pay. For example, a provident fund of 12% of basic pay is deducted from salary.
Variable pay, also known as pay for performance or risk pay, is a type of remuneration that must be earned every time, as opposed to fixed pay. Variable pay is not guaranteed and is only paid if specific qualitative or quantitative goals are met by individual employees, teams, or the organization.
